Start with a simple sentence which explains your specific area of study, avoiding jargon, in the first person. So: “My research focuses on...” Then, step back and provide a line to give context: why is your research important? Now explain your work in more detail. What are you looking at specifically, and how do you do it?

A Researcher Profile may also be called a Biographical Sketch (or “Bio Sketch”). Reviewers utilize the bio sketch to ensure that individuals are equipped with the skills, knowledge, and resources necessary to carry out the proposed research.

Global bibliographic databases and search platforms, such as Scopus, Web of Science, PubMed, and Google Scholar, are widely used for profiling authors with indexed publications. Scholarly networking websites, such as ResearchGate and Academia.edu, provide indispensable services for researchers poorly visible elsewhere on the Internet.
